Concrete Staining Gives Retail Stores a More Upscale Look Without Starting Over

One reason a retail store would hire a Concrete Staining Palm Beach business is value. Full flooring replacement can be disruptive, expensive, and time-consuming. Concrete staining allows a store to upgrade the look of existing concrete without the same level of demolition, haul-away, and rebuild costs that often come with other flooring systems. For many retailers, that means they can improve the appearance of their space while keeping more capital available for inventory, staffing, merchandising, and marketing.

Just as important, stained concrete can be tailored to fit the store’s identity. A boutique may want a warm, polished finish that feels elegant and coastal. A lifestyle store may want a richer, earth-toned floor that feels grounded and high-end. A sneaker shop or modern apparel store may want a sharper, more contemporary look with clean lines and a sleek sheen. When the staining work is done by a qualified local business, the floor becomes part of the brand experience instead of just a surface people walk on. That ability to transform ordinary concrete into a more refined retail feature is a major reason Palm Beach stores benefit from hiring a local specialist rather than trying to cover the floor with a temporary solution.

Palm Beach Stores Need Finishes That Support Cleanliness and Maintenance

Retail stores have to stay clean. Dust, tracked-in sand, rainwater, spills, and daily wear can quickly make certain flooring materials look tired. Palm Beach’s coastal conditions make that even more important. A retail store needs a floor that can be cleaned efficiently and maintained without constant patchwork. Stained concrete offers a practical advantage because it does not carry the same issues as some flooring materials that trap debris, peel, fray, or require frequent replacement.

A professionally stained and sealed concrete floor can simplify routine upkeep and help the store maintain a cleaner appearance between major cleanings. That cleaner look supports brand trust.
